Product information "Anti-LPGAT1"
Protein function: Catalyzes the transfert of an acyl group from an acyl-CoA to a lysophosphatidylglycerol (LPG) leading to biosynthesis of phosphatidylglycerol, a precursor for cardiolipin synthesis (PubMed:15485873). Uses various acyl-CoAs and LPGs as substrates but demonstrates a clear preference for long chain saturated fatty acyl- CoAs and oleoyl-CoA as acyl donors (PubMed:15485873). Prefers oleoyl- LPG over palmitoyl-LPG as an acyl receptor and oleoyl-CoA over lauroyl- CoA as an acyl donor (PubMed:15485873). In vitro can also catalyzes the transfert of an acyl group from an acyl-CoA to a monoacylglycerol leading to diacylglycerol synthesis, a precursor of triacylglycerol and plays a role in hepatic triacylglycerol synthesis and secretion. Prefers the sn-2-monoacylglycerol to rac-1- monoacylglycerol as acyl acceptor. [The UniProt Consortium]

Properties
| Application: | WB |
| Antibody Type: | Polyclonal |
| Conjugate: | No |
| Host: | Rabbit |
| Species reactivity: | human, mouse, rat |
| Immunogen: | Human LPGAT1 Synthesized peptide |
| MW: | 43 kD |
| Format: | Antigen Affinity Purified |
